Creating Physical & Emotional Security in Schools (2nd Edition) offers tools and strategies to teach Kż8 principals how to build caring learning communities. In this addition to the Essentials for Principals series, author Kenneth C. Williams addresses behavior, conflict, and crisis management and presents practical, research-based methods for developing a welcoming, supportive school environment. By setting high expectations for students, teachers, and themselves, principals can instill the confidence and security necessary for student success. Readers will learn how to build healthy relationships with students, reach out to families and community members, and support teachers through instruction, communication, and collaboration. In chapter 1, Williams defines a caring learning community and gives school leaders the tools to develop one. He details the ways principals can nurture supportive relationships with their students, cultivate student initiative and resilience, establish high expectations for staff, students, and other stakeholders, encourage parent involvement, and create a positive, welcoming school environment. Chapter 2 shows principals how to help students deal with conflict and anger, how to integrate conflict management strategies into the school culture, and how to develop schoolwide conflict-management strategies for problem solving and conflict resolution. Chapter 3 examines how to develop an effective schoolwide policy for behavior and discipline that focuses on teaching behavioral expectations, how to use data for plan improvement, and when to use the office to address problematic behavior. The author shows principals how to address and prevent bullying, including cyberbullying, and how to enlist the help of parents and school counselors in chapter 4. Chapter 5 addresses issues of safety and security and provides tips for creating a physically safe environment and planning for a crisis. The Afterword provides some final thoughts for school leaders.

"Research shows that access to nature, big classroom windows, and open campuses along active streets reduce stress, anxiety, disorderly conduct, and crime. Yet, too many American public schools look and feel like prisons. They are designed out of fear of vandalism, truancy, and added maintenance costs. Despite decades of research demonstrating the benefits of restorative school environments for students' mental, physical, and academic success, they aren't yet part of mainstream conversations about mental health and wellbeing, or school planning, design, maintenance, and safety. Restorative school environments can invite and build a broad community around our children and adolescents; improve the quality of the neighborhood; reduce students' anxiety and aggression; and make them feel safer, more hopeful, and whole. Schools That Heal explains the compelling connections between human health and school design, and look at how investing in school design elements-large and small- that promote health can positively impact both students and the entire community, promoting resilience and environmental justice"--

Though decades ago school shootings were rare events, today they are becoming normalized. Active shooter drills have become more commonplace as pressure is placed on schools and law enforcement to prevent the next attack. Yet others argue the traumatizing effects of such exercises on the students. Additionally, violence between students continues to remain problematic as bullying pervades children’s lives both at school and at home, leading to negative mental health impacts and, in extreme cases, suicide. Establishing safer school policies, promoting violence prevention programs, building healthier classroom environments, and providing better staff training are all vital for protecting students physically and mentally.
